Revitalizing North Baltimore: The York Road Free Music and Arts Festival

The York Road Free Music and Arts Festival is a beacon of hope for north Baltimore, aiming to bridge communities and revitalize the area. Supported by Loyola University and Notre Dame of Maryland University, the event is a part of the York Road Improvement District's efforts to create inclusive public spaces.

Uniting Communities

The festival brings together residents on both sides of York Road, showcasing local vendors and live music to promote unity and diversity.

Transforming Public Spaces

Initiatives like transforming Lortz Lane and creating a new park space highlight the commitment to revitalization.

Safety and Inclusivity

The organization focuses on safety, implementing security measures, and ensuring equitable representation from all communities. The York Road Free Music and Arts Festival is not just an event - it's a step towards a brighter, more connected future for north Baltimore.
